BACKGROUND: Tooth wear is a multifactorial complex process related to the loss of dental tissue, due to chemical or mechanical processes, by abrasion, attrition, erosion. Restorative treatment represents an attempt to rebuild and recreate the lost structure. OBJECTIVE: This scoping review aims to investigate whether restorative treatment of worn dentition (either with direct or indirect adhesive composite adhesive procedures or with prosthetic techniques) can have an impact on the masticatory performance parameters. METHODS: A scoping review was conducted on multiple databases (Pubmed, Medline CENTRAL, ICTRP), following the PRISMA guidelines. Abstracts of research papers were screened for suitability, and full-text articles were obtained for those who satisfied the inclusion and exclusion criteria. RESULTS: Only one article meet the inclusion criteria of the review. Restorative treatment of worn dentition although have a positive impact on the self-report ability to chew, has no effect on the masticatory performance test. CONCLUSION: At the moment, not enough evidence to comment on the actual therapeutic role of restorative treatment on tooth wear is available. Clinicians, before taking any clinical decision, should carefully discuss with patients the needs and expectations of the treatment plan.

The aim of this systematic review was to determine the success rate of nitrous oxide-oxygen procedural sedation (NOIS) in dentistry. A systematic digital search was conducted for publications or reports of randomized controlled trials evaluating the clinical performance of NOIS. Abstracts of research papers were screened for suitability, and full-text articles were obtained for those who met the inclusion and exclusion criteria accordingly. The quality of the studies was assessed using the revised Cochrane risk-of-bias tool (RoB 2). A total of 19 articles (eight randomized clinical trials with parallel intervention groups and 11 crossover trials), published between May 1988 and August 2019, were finally selected for this review. The studies followed 1293 patients reporting NOIS success rates, with a cumulative mean value of 94.9% (95% CI: 88.8-98.9%). Thirteen trials were conducted on pediatric populations (1098 patients), and the remaining six were conducted on adults (195 patients), with cumulative efficacy rates of 91.9% (95% CI: 82.5-98.1%) and 99.9% (95% CI: 97.7-100.0%), respectively. The difference was statistically significant (P = 0.002). Completion of treatment and Section IV of the Houpt scale were the most used efficacy criteria. Within the limitations of this systematic review, the present study provides important information on the efficacy rate of NOIS. However, further well-designed and well-documented clinical trials are required and there is a need to develop guidelines for standardization of criteria and definition of success in procedural sedation. Currently, completion of treatment is the most used parameter in clinical practice, though many others also do exist at the same time. To maximize NOIS efficacy, clinicians should strictly consider appropriate indications for the procedure.
